Following Lin Xiaoman's suggestion, Yang Hanmo wrote a letter of sympathy that would make men silent and women cry. Then he treated the group of people from the court to delicious food and drinks, and gave them a sum of money before asking them to leave.

After the people left, the brother and sister discussed it and decided that Lin Xiaoman would take the hot documents they had just received and a group of unfamiliar faces and go to Taiyi City openly.

The identities are all ready, such as Lin Xiaoman’s badge as the deputy officer of the Golden Scale Guard.

All functions of Tongzhou have been restored, and the disaster victims who were originally waiting for relief at the gates of Taiyi City have returned to their towns and villages.

Although the city gate was not wide open, Taiyi City also had a small gate open, so anyone with a clear identity could enter the city.

Yang Hanmo, along with a group of more than a dozen people, also entered the city under the pretext of escorting a special envoy from the imperial court.

Although the prefect Sun Tongmao had a complete falling out with Yang Hanmo, Yang Hanmo did not bring any troops with him, so Sun Tongmao was not afraid of him at all.

After entering the city, Lin Xiaoman saw Sun Tongmao, the black-hearted crow that Yang Hanmo mentioned.

With a greasy face, fat head and ears, and a big belly, Sun Tongmao is obviously a corrupt official.

Lin Xiaoman acted like a proper official to the other officials in Tongtaiyi City, and because they had official documents with seals on them, Sun Tongmao had no doubts at all.

Sun Tongmao also heard about Yang Hanmo's large-scale purchase of grain. He just thought that Emperor Wu Sheng remembered his son and gave him money.

As a shameless person, Sun Tongmao confessed to Yang Hanmo as if nothing had happened, complaining and shirking responsibility, "I have no choice, I really have no food..."

Balabala.

Yang Hanmo looked unhappy at first, but then he acted as if, "Although I don't like you, I can't get rid of you, so I can only shake hands and make peace with you." This was considered a reconciliation between him and Sun Tongmao.

Both the host and the guests were in great joy, with fine wine and delicious food. A group of people toasted each other, drinking and chatting happily until the middle of the night.

It was too abrupt to take action right after entering the city. On the first day, Lin Xiaoman originally planned to behave himself and not take action, but this person came to him on his own initiative.

After a satisfying meal and a few drinks, just when Lin Xiaoman wanted to rest, Sun Tongmao came over quietly, trying to get close to her in various ways, and said, "This is just a small token of my respect, but I hope Yuan Chenshi will accept it."

Sun Tongmao very considerately handed her a box.

Without even looking, Lin Xiaoman knew the box contained banknotes.

Bribing officials from the capital is an unwritten rule, and Sun Tongmao is certainly a person who understands the rules very well.

Although the Jinlinwei assistant was only a fourth-rank official, the Jinlinwei were directly under the emperor and could make direct suggestions to the emperor. Sometimes, if the Jinlinwei called someone a "rebel", that person would become a rebel even if they were not already one.

Fearing that Lin Xiaoman would gossip in front of the emperor and team up with Yang Hanmo to implicate him, Sun Tongmao did not dare to be negligent at all and spent a large sum of money to bring Lin Xiaoman to his camp.

After giving the money, Sun Tongmao started to complain again. To sum it up, it was because Prince Mo was not good at resisting the disaster. He was just a small prefect and could only listen to the prince.

Sun Tongmao threw dirty water on Yang Hanmo and said he was innocent.

Lin Xiaoman took a look at the banknotes. Wow, it was a full 20,000 taels!

Fat! Too fat! This is definitely a fat sheep!

After receiving the money, Lin Xiaoman smiled and said on the spot that he would stand on his side. He generously poisoned the wine and gave him a glass of poisoned wine.

Of course, chronic poisons take effect slowly, and only after a few days do they show any effect.

The next day, Lin Xiaoman very willfully proposed to go hunting.

Sun Tongmao, who tried his best to win over Lin Xiaoman, naturally agreed to every request. However, as a civil servant, he was a weakling in martial arts, so the job of accompanying the hunting fell on the military officer.

Yang Hanmo had discussed this with Lin Xiaoman and knew that she was going to do something shady today, so he took the initiative to avoid going. Lin Xiaoman and his group went with Wei Hu, the commander of the city defense army.

Wei Hu is Su Tongmao's son-in-law. They are birds of a feather. As long as these two fall, the remaining people will not be a threat at all.

After leaving the city, Lin Xiaoman suddenly became interested and asked for a horse race. Everyone had no choice but to do as she wished. With a flick of the whip, the horses started galloping away.

Seizing the right opportunity, Lin Xiaoman secretly released his internal strength and knocked Wei Hu down secretly. Wei Hu, who was no match for Lin Xiaoman, didn't even know where the attack came from and fell off his horse. Several of his subordinates behind him were unable to avoid him and the scene of a major car accident immediately became a scene.

After all, Wei Hu had some basic martial arts skills and quick reaction, so even though he held his head, he did not die, but he felt unconscious.

"Commander Wei!" Lin Xiaoman came forward to check the situation with a look of concern. While helping the man, he secretly poked and pricked the man's spine with a small silver needle. He guaranteed that this guy would be a paralyzed bedridden man in his next life.

Very good, one done.

He left the city happily but returned to the city in a gloomy mood. When he heard the news that Wei Hu had been arrested, Su Tongmao was completely stunned. He immediately called over all of Wei Hu's men who had accompanied him and questioned them carefully.

Everyone said the same thing: Wei Hu was accidentally brought down.

Although he still felt something was wrong, these were all Wei Hu's confidants, and it was impossible for all of them to be bribed by Yang Hanmo. Su Tongmao could only believe that this was an accident.

After being diagnosed by the doctors, Wei Hu was confirmed to be disabled.

Once this man was dismissed, the position of the commander of the defending army became vacant. Sun Tongmao and Yang Hanmo secretly competed with each other, both wanting to push their own people up.
